This is an automated email from the ASF dual-hosted git repository.
albumenj pushed a change to branch 3.2
in repository https://gitbox.apache.org/repos/asf/dubbo.git
from fb00a8a391 Follow #11262, disable cache (#12171)
add a1a83873d6 Feature/dubbo3.2 rest demo (#12183)
No new revisions were added by this update.
Summary of changes:
dubbo-demo/dubbo-demo-interface/pom.xml | 7 +-
.../apache/dubbo/demo/rest/api/CurlService.java | 25 +++--
.../rest/api/DubboServiceAnnotationService.java | 18 ++--
.../demo/rest/api/ExceptionMapperService.java | 15 +--
.../dubbo/demo/rest/api}/HttpMethodService.java | 30 ++++--
.../HttpRequestAndResponseRPCContextService.java | 33 ++++---
.../dubbo/demo/rest/api/JaxRsRestDemoService.java | 67 ++++++-------
.../demo/rest/api}/SpringRestDemoService.java | 51 ++++++----
.../src/main/java/po}/User.java | 50 +++++-----
.../pom.xml | 52 +++++++---
.../apache/dubbo/demo/rest/api/RestConsumer.java | 107 +++++++++++++++++++++
.../demo/rest/api/SpringControllerService.java | 27 ++----
.../dubbo/demo/rest/api/config/DubboConfig.java | 10 +-
.../src/main/resources/spring/rest-consumer.xml} | 31 +++---
.../pom.xml | 54 ++++++++---
.../apache/dubbo/demo/rest/api/RestProvider.java} | 24 ++++-
.../dubbo/demo/rest/api/config/DubboConfig.java | 10 +-
.../rest/api/extension/ExceptionMapperForTest.java | 14 ++-
.../dubbo/demo/rest/api/impl/CurlServiceImpl.java | 15 +--
.../impl/DubboServiceAnnotationServiceImpl.java | 14 ++-
.../rest/api/impl/ExceptionMapperServiceImpl.java | 17 ++--
.../demo/rest/api/impl}/HttpMethodServiceImpl.java | 36 ++++---
...ttpRequestAndResponseRPCContextServiceImpl.java | 53 ++++++++++
.../rest/api/impl/JaxRsRestDemoServiceImpl.java | 72 +++++++-------
.../src/main/resources/spring/rest-provider.xml | 59 ++++++++++++
dubbo-demo/dubbo-demo-xml/pom.xml | 2 +
26 files changed, 601 insertions(+), 292 deletions(-)
copy
dubbo-common/src/main/java/org/apache/dubbo/common/context/LifecycleAdapter.java
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api/CurlService.java
(70%)
copy
dubbo-monitor/dubbo-monitor-default/src/test/java/org/apache/dubbo/monitor/dubbo/service/DemoService.java
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api/DubboServiceAnnotationService.java
(74%)
copy
dubbo-monitor/dubbo-monitor-default/src/test/java/org/apache/dubbo/monitor/dubbo/service/DemoService.java
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api/ExceptionMapperService.java
(77%)
copy
{d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/rest
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api}/HttpMethodService.java
(67%)
copy
d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/rest/RestDemoForTestException.java
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api/HttpRequestAndResponseRPCContextService.java
(60%)
copy
d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/DemoService.java
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api/JaxRsRestDemoService.java
(69%)
copy
{d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/mvc
=>
dubbo-demo/dubbo-demo-interface/src/main/java/org/apache/dubbo/demo/rest/api}/SpringRestDemoService.java
(56%)
copy {dubbo-common/src/test/java/org/apache/dubbo/common/model =>
dubbo-demo/dubbo-demo-interface/src/main/java/po}/User.java (68%)
copy dubbo-demo/dubbo-demo-xml/{dubbo-demo-xml-provider =>
dubbo-demo-jaxrs-rest-consumer}/pom.xml (77%)
create mode 100644
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-consumer/src/main/java/org/apache/dubbo/demo/rest/api/RestConsumer.java
copy
dubbo-cluster/src/main/java/org/apache/dubbo/rpc/cluster/router/mesh/rule/virtualservice/match/BoolMatch.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-consumer/src/main/java/org/apache/dubbo/demo/rest/api/SpringControllerService.java
(66%)
copy
dubbo-cluster/src/main/java/org/apache/dubbo/rpc/cluster/router/mesh/rule/destination/TCPSettings.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-consumer/src/main/java/org/apache/dubbo/demo/rest/api/config/DubboConfig.java
(80%)
copy
dubbo-demo/dubbo-demo-xml/{dubbo-demo-xml-consumer/src/main/resources/spring/dubbo-consumer.xml
=> dubbo-demo-jaxrs-rest-consumer/src/main/resources/spring/rest-consumer.xml}
(50%)
copy dubbo-demo/dubbo-demo-xml/{dubbo-demo-xml-provider =>
dubbo-demo-jaxrs-rest-provider}/pom.xml (76%)
copy
dubbo-demo/dubbo-demo-xml/{dubbo-demo-xml-provider/src/main/java/org/apache/dubbo/demo/provider/Application.java
=>
d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/RestProvider.java}
(61%)
copy
dubbo-cluster/src/main/java/org/apache/dubbo/rpc/cluster/router/mesh/rule/destination/TCPSettings.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/config/DubboConfig.java
(80%)
copy
dubbo-common/src/main/java/org/apache/dubbo/common/concurrent/DiscardPolicy.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/extension/ExceptionMapperForTest.java
(73%)
copy
dubbo-config/dubbo-config-spring/src/test/java/org/apache/dubbo/config/spring/boot/importxml2/HelloServiceImpl.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l/CurlServiceImpl.java
(74%)
copy
dubbo-config/dubbo-config-spring/src/test/java/org/apache/dubbo/config/spring/boot/importxml2/HelloServiceImpl.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l/DubboServiceAnnotationServiceImpl.java
(72%)
copy
dubbo-common/src/main/java/org/apache/dubbo/common/context/LifecycleAdapter.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l/ExceptionMapperServiceImpl.java
(69%)
copy
{d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/rest
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l}/HttpMethodServiceImpl.java
(56%)
create mode 100644
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l/HttpRequestAndResponseRPCContextServiceImpl.java
copy
dubbo-rpc/dubbo-rpc-rest/src/test/java/org/apache/dubbo/rpc/protocol/rest/mvc/SpringDemoServiceImpl.java
=>
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/java/org/apache/dubbo/demo/rest/api/impl/JaxRsRestDemoServiceImpl.java
(62%)
create mode 100644
dubbo-demo/dubbo-demo-xml/dubbo-demo-jaxrs-rest-provider/src/main/resources/spring/rest-provider.xml